The EMC V4-2S10-012 1.2TB 10K RPM 2.5-inch SAS HDD is designed specifically for VNX2 storage arrays, offering a balance between capacity and speed. It fits into enterprise environments that demand consistent performance and compact storage solutions, serving as a reliable component in mid-range to high-end storage deployments. |

Technical Information |
|
|---|---|
| Capacity | 1.2TB |
| Form Factor | 2.5-inch |
| Spindle Speed | 10000 RPM |
| Hot Pluggable | Yes |
| Hot Swappable | Yes |
| Hybrid Drive | No |
| Compatible For | VNX2 |
Interfaces/Ports |
|
|---|---|
| Interface | SAS 6Gb/s |

This EMC V4-2S10-012 is a 1.2TB 10K RPM SAS hard drive designed for use in VNX2 storage systems. It’s built to handle demanding data workloads where consistent performance and reliability are important. Often found in enterprise environments, it supports storage arrays that require efficient data retrieval and handling. Key Features
These drives are commonly deployed in data centers and enterprise storage setups where space is limited but performance can’t be compromised. They help maintain steady access speeds and reliability across large amounts of data, making them an essential part of many VNX2 configurations. |
